5 Phases of Penetration Testing
Penetration Testing plays a crucial role in a well-rounded cybersecurity strategy. This form of testing allows organizations to uncover vulnerabilities in their systems and initiate the right remediation measures. Often referred to as pen testing, this process is segmented into five essential steps or phases. Understanding these steps can empower you to create a representative penetration test plan that your organization can implement, thereby bolstering its security measures. Including application penetration testing services (check this site for more information) in your security plan is a proactive way to enhance your system's defenses against potential cyber threats.

1. Reconnaissance
The first phase of the penetration testing process is reconnaissance. Here, the penetration testers gather as much information about the target system as possible. This can include details about IP addresses, domain details, and mail servers. Reconnaissance helps outline the landscape before the actual pen-testing steps are initiated. Information gathered during this phase helps to shape the penetration testing plan, focusing on identified areas of potential vulnerability.
2. Scanning
Once the initial information is gathered, the next phase involves scanning the target system. During this phase, penetration testers use various tools to understand how the target system responds to different intrusion attempts. Scanning is a crucial phase in the penetration testing process, as it provides testers with an understanding of potential vulnerabilities. Techniques used might include port scanning or automated vulnerability scanning, which help to lay the groundwork for the following steps of penetration testing.
3. Vulnerability Assessment
With the insights gathered from the scanning phase, the next step is the vulnerability assessment. This phase involves analyzing the data obtained during scanning to identify vulnerabilities that can be exploited. The assessment should prioritize the vulnerabilities based on factors such as potential impact and exploitability. The goal is to form an understanding of which areas pose the greatest risk and which should therefore be addressed first.
4. Exploitation
After assessing and prioritizing the vulnerabilities, the next phase of penetration testing is exploitation. Here, the identified vulnerabilities are exploited to see if unauthorized access to the system is possible. This phase provides a real-world example of what might happen if an attacker were to exploit these vulnerabilities. The exploitation phase is crucial as it moves beyond theoretical risks, demonstrating what a potential breach might look like and the potential damage it could cause.

5. Reporting
The last stage of the penetration testing process is the compilation of a report. Following the completion of the penetration test, an in-depth report needs to be generated. This report should highlight the identified vulnerabilities, and any successful breaches, and provide recommendations to address these risks. A useful report is one that leads to action, helping organizations comprehend and apply necessary adjustments to bolster their system security. This phase is pivotal as it transitions from evaluating vulnerabilities to executing actionable steps for improving cybersecurity protections.
Conclusion
An active step towards improving the cyber security of an organization is to conduct a penetration test. By following these 5 steps of penetration testing—reconnaissance, scanning, vulnerability assessment, exploitation, and reporting—enterprises can significantly improve their security. By learning how to do penetration testing, whether it's for a website or a broader network, organizations can actively defend against potential threats, making the cyber world a safer place.